Bridge supporting device with adjusting structure for bridge construction
The invention discloses a bridge construction bridge supporting device with an adjusting structure, which comprises a base and a supporting column mounted at the upper end of the base through bolts, a supporting platform is fixedly mounted at the upper end of the supporting column, a hydraulic rod is arranged on the outer side of the upper end of the supporting platform, and a moving block is fixedly mounted at the output end of the hydraulic rod. And a first supporting rod is rotationally mounted at the upper end of the moving block. According to the bridge construction bridge supporting device with the adjusting structure, the fixing cone capable of achieving automatic fixing is arranged, the non-band-type brake motor is driven to drive the threaded rod fixedly installed at the output end of the bottom to rotate, meanwhile, the output end of the non-band-type brake motor rotates to stretch the vortex spring, and when the threaded rod rotates, the vortex spring can rotate; and the fixing cone with the bottom in threaded connection with the threaded rod descends under the limiting of the perforated plate and the limiting rod and can be embedded into the bottom to further fix the device, the stability of the device is improved, and the overall deviation of the device can be effectively prevented.
